Output e89b9a94639de2df7b6146956ec7c6646cc84cac3bcd231e3add2fbe1efdd630:1

value
3624962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3766305a51a566907a0937ebcc24b4cd1942b OP_EQUAL
address
3BMEXkemxZbYAJzHxmMajmU8MZVv3JSt7Y
transaction
e89b9a94639de2df7b6146956ec7c6646cc84cac3bcd231e3add2fbe1efdd630
spent
true